Wysocki wrote: > > > > On Mon, Jun 26, 2017 at 10:38 AM, Lukas Wunner wrote: > > > > > Hi Robert, > > > > > > > > > > ACPICA commit c8eac101 (= Linux commit a83019eb9f1f, "ACPICA: Update > > > > > resource descriptor handling") is causing a regression when parsing > > > > > an empty ResourceTemplate: > > > > Can it be fixed by using this logic: > > if (AmlLength < sizeof (AML_RESOURCE_END_TAG) && AmlLength) > > Instead of the logic introduced in commit a83019eb9f1f? > > if (AmlLength < sizeof (AML_RESOURCE_END_TAG)) > > Unfortunately not, AmlLength is not 0 but 2 in this case > (= sizeof(struct aml_resource_end_tag)). Actually, that will work here (the use of '<' ensures that). But it's unclear whether this is semantically the correct thing, in particular because a83019eb9f1f widened the cases where NO_RESOURCE_END_TAG is returned, but the above suggestion narrows them. Unfortunately commit a83019eb9f1f is quite vague about why it reverted back to '<='. Cheers, Ronald
